I wouldn't do it. That could potentially destroy the bass, and you might not hear that much of a difference, and now you would be stuck with a chopped up warwick. I would look at your amp/preamp situation first. Tube power usually has a vintage sound, and I'm not familiar with peavey preamps, but I would really start there before you do something irreversible.
 
I haven't put humbuckers in mine, but I think if you maybe looked at upgrading the preamp to something with a lower bass center frequency, somewhere below 100hz you might find you can get a wider more modern sound from it... I don't find the thumb 5string to be not modern sounding, it just has a certain tone because of the two backwards sloping J pickups, the 4 string with the more forward neck pickup is much more balanced sounding to my ear
